Interview with Jimgon21 on You've Been Tagged.

Q: So, I was just curious, how'd you come up with your nickname?

A: Hahaha Jimgon21 is a mix between two of my favorite fictional characters, Jimmy Coates and Eragon. And 21 is just one of my favorite numbers :)

Q: So, your story, You’ve Been Tagged, revolves around a murderer who contacted his victim through Facebook. Do you have a Facebook? Do you use it a lot?

A: Yes, I do have a Facebook :). I check it every day, but I'm not obsessed haha.

Q: What gave you the idea for this story?

A: Honestly, the idea came while doing the dishes. It just popped in my mind, and I thought it was cool.

Q: Chase grows throughout the story. Was Chase based off of anyone? Does he resemble you at all?

A: Chase was loosely based on myself, but not really on anybody else. He just kinda grew naturally :)

Q: The story involved a lot of clever thinking and twists and turns. Did you have to do a lot of research to learn about how the police system works? Was it tedious? Was it fun?

A: To be perfectly honest, I didn't really do much research on the police system. I have a few policemen that I know personally, and added a few details I learned from them.

Q: How long did it take to plan out your story? It seems very detailed and intricate.

A: You're gonna hate me when I say this, but I had no outline for this book. Each chapter wasn't too planned, it literally wrote itself haha.

Q: What was the revision and editing process like? How long did it take?

A: Revision and editing took longer than I had hoped. I had two editors, and the story being as long as it is took some time.

Q: How did you go about getting your book published? Is it your first? How do you feel about being a published author?

A: I self-published on lulu.com. It is my second published book, but the first is not available online. However, the book "Double Take" is available to read on here :) Being published is awesome! Hahaha It's a great feeling :)

Q: Do you have anything to say to other aspiring authors out there who want to get published?

A: DON'T GIVE UP!!! Hahaha check out lulu and self-publish if you want!

Q: What was the most difficult part of writing the story?

A: Umm...changing who "Unknown" was halfway through the story and not being able to change it :) Everybody guessed Detective Daniels, and that was who it was originally :)

Q: How do your fans play into your story? Are they what keep you going?

The fans were VERY important. After the first few chapters, they had guessed whom "Unknown" was, so I had to change him haha.
